Cecilia joins SMT fleet
A heart-felt welcome to our newest vessel, MV Cecilia – the latest milestone in our great partnership with Carisbrooke Shipping Ltd. With a deadweight of 33,395DWT on a 9.8 meter draft, Cecilia is uniquely suitable for shallow drafted ports. She features 4x30 ton cranes manned by expert onboard crane drivers – and she will soon have 4 x 10CBM grabs as well. SMT Shipping wishes safe journeys to the crew of MV Cecilia, and we look forward to a great future together.
